Located off the coast of Dunedin, Florida, Caladesi Island State Park is a tranquil and breathtaking destination for nature lovers and adventure seekers alike. This pristine barrier island boasts six miles of untouched beach, mangrove forests, and crystal-clear waters perfect for exploring by paddleboard.

As you step onto the sandy shores of Caladesi, you'll be immediately immersed in the sights and sounds of the Gulf Coast's unique ecosystem. Keep an eye out for marine life such as dolphins, sea turtles, and colorful fish darting through the shallow waters. The island's mangrove tunnels provide a perfect spot to observe birds like herons, egrets, and ospreys.

Preparing for Your Paddleboard Adventure

Before setting off on your paddleboard journey, make sure you're prepared with the necessary gear:

  • Rent or bring a suitable paddleboard: Caladesi's waters can be calm but also choppy in some areas; consider renting an inflatable or hard-top board.
  • Wear comfortable clothing and shoes: A soft-top paddleboard is a great option for this trip, as you'll want to wear water-friendly shoes with a good grip.
  • Don't forget sunscreen, snacks, and plenty of water: Protect yourself from the sun's strong rays and stay hydrated throughout your adventure.

Paddling through the Mangroves

Paddling through Caladesi's mangrove tunnels is an unforgettable experience. The twisted roots of these ancient trees create a maze-like passage that feels like exploring an alien world.

  • Take your time and observe the intricate network of roots and vegetation.
  • Listen for the calls of birds echoing through the tunnels, adding to the sense of adventure.

Exploring the Island's Shores

Once you've navigated the mangrove tunnels, take a moment to explore the island's shores. Keep an eye out for shells, sea glass, or driftwood that has washed up on the beach.

  • Take a break and enjoy the serene atmosphere; Caladesi is an ideal spot to practice yoga, meditate, or simply relax.

Best Times to Visit

The best time to visit Caladesi Island State Park depends on your preferences. Peak season (December to April) offers calm waters and mild temperatures, while shoulder season (May to June and September to November) provides fewer crowds and slightly cooler temperatures.

  • Avoid visiting during strong winds or thunderstorms, as these can make the paddling experience challenging.

Getting Around

To get to Caladesi Island State Park:

  • Rent a kayak or paddleboard from a nearby outfitter or bring your own equipment.
  • Launch from the Dunedin Causeway and paddle north towards the island.

Practical Info

For up-to-date information on park hours, fees, and regulations, visit the Florida State Parks website. Be sure to check the official source for any changes before planning your trip.
